    Economic and Social Impact of Thalassemia in Cambodia: Challenges and Strategic Solutions
    (December 1, 2024) Shamila Ramjawan, MBA, TEFL
    Thalassemia, a hereditary blood disorder characterized by abnormal hemoglobin production, presents significant health challenges in various regions worldwide, including Cambodia. This genetic condition leads to the destruction of red blood cells, causing anemia and other severe complications. In Cambodia, thalassemia affects thousands of people annually, with a significant number of cases identified in younger populations. Awareness and understanding of thalassemia in Cambodia have gradually increased over the past decade thanks to efforts by health organizations, government initiatives, and international collaborations. However, despite these efforts, the management and treatment of thalassemia face significant obstacles. Severe thalassemia diseases are a major health problem in Southeast Asia.
